Navigating the labyrinthine nature of sophistication demands robust conceptual frameworks. These structures provide lenses through which we can analyze complex systems, identifying patterns and relationships that might otherwise remain obscured. A multitude of frameworks exist, each with read more its own unique viewpoint . Some emphasize breaking down systems into their fundamental components , while others embrace holism

One prominent framework is systems thinking, which views elements as interconnected within a dynamic network . This approach encourages us to consider the consequential properties that arise from these interactions. Another influential perspective is chaos theory, which highlights the sensitivity of complex systems to initial variables. Even seemingly small changes can have significant consequences, illustrating the inherent unpredictability of many situations.
